小编kri*_*sal的帖子

+(加号)登录Web API路由

我正在使用asp.net web api项目,我必须通过帖子传递手机号码.但我不能返回一个加号.

我的路线:

config.Routes.MapHttpRoute( 
    name: "SmsRoute",
    routeTemplate: "rest/sms/{country}/{company}/phone/{mobilenumber}",
    defaults: new { controller = "Sms", action = "PostSms" });
Run Code Online (Sandbox Code Playgroud)

控制器:

public HttpResponseMessage PostSms(string country, string company, string mobilenumber)
{
    return Request.CreateResponse( HttpStatusCode.Created );
}
Run Code Online (Sandbox Code Playgroud)

当我在fiddler上运行这个post方法时:

http://index.html/rest/sms/se/company/phone/46700101010/messages/out
Run Code Online (Sandbox Code Playgroud)

我收到了这个回复:

在此输入图像描述

但我希望它能够向我展示加号.

c# asp.net-web-api asp.net-web-api-routing

18
推荐指数
2
解决办法
5258
查看次数

无法将图像上载到SharePoint列表

我正在使用Visual WebPart,我想将我的FileUpload控件中的图像上传到SharePoint列表.这是我正在使用的代码,但我无法让它工作,(标题,prodnum,颜色等工作,但不是图像).我也安装了SparQube.

这是我的ListView: 图片http://i47.tinypic.com/x5z2v7.jpg.

protected void Button_Save_Click(object sender, EventArgs e)
{
    SPSite currentSite = SPContext.Current.Site;
    SPList myList = currentSite.RootWeb.Lists.TryGetList("SharePointDatabase");

    try
    {
        if (myList != null && FileUpload_Pic.PostedFile != null && FileUpload_Pic.HasFile)
        {
            SPListItem listItem = myList.Items.Add();

            listItem["Title"] = TextBox_Name.Text;
            listItem["ProductNumber"] = TextBox_ProdNum.Text;
            listItem["Color"] = TextBox_Color.Text;
            listItem["ListPrice"] = TextBox_ListPrice.Text;
            listItem["MoreInformation"] = TextBox_MoreInfo.Text;

            string fileName = Path.GetFileName(FileUpload_Pic.PostedFile.FileName);
            listItem["Image"] = fileName;

            listItem.Update();                                            

            TextBox_Search.Text = string.Empty;
            TextBox_Name.Text = string.Empty;
            TextBox_MoreInfo.Text = string.Empty;
            TextBox_ProdNum.Text = string.Empty;
            TextBox_Color.Text = string.Empty;
            TextBox_ListPrice.Text = string.Empty; …
Run Code Online (Sandbox Code Playgroud)

c# sharepoint sharepoint-2010

8
推荐指数
1
解决办法
1983
查看次数

Linq到Sql查询,dateiff + -3天

我正在使用航班页面.现在我在我的数据库中有一些航班,我想显示它们.通过此查询,我将显示所选日期的所有航班(asp:日历控件):

var destinationFlights = 
    (from a in db.Flights
     where a.DepartureAirportId == depId && a.DestinationAirportId == destId && a.DepartureDate == depDate
     join Airports a1 in db.Airports on a.Airports.AirportName equals a1.AirportName
     join Airports a2 in db.Airports on a.Airports1.AirportName equals a2.AirportName
     select a).ToList();
Run Code Online (Sandbox Code Playgroud)

我想要实现的是,例如,如果我从日历表单中选择日期(2014-10-10),我希望查询在表格中搜索,并在选定日期的+ -3天间隔内显示所有航班.有什么建议?

c# asp.net entity-framework linq-to-sql

2
推荐指数
1
解决办法
1737
查看次数